Transaction 87120be88f62622566c64c12e475e8134519cb398f8d3c67bdfa16873fea359a
1 Input
1 Output
-
87120be88f62622566c64c12e475e8134519cb398f8d3c67bdfa16873fea359a:0
- value
- 552010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f98f7701a3a11138b2eed7cca841749b6de0697 OP_EQUAL
- address
- 3GEtcM6bxw9w1XtKGE44VsjzVveHiMzg5P